Luke 9:28-36

Mace(i) 28 About eight days after this discourse, he took with him Peter, John, and James, and went up a mountain to pray. 29 as he was praying, the appearance of his countenance was quite chang'd, and his raiment was of a splendid white: 30 two persons of a glorious form were seen talking with him; they were Moses, and Elias, 31 who discours'd about the exit, he was to make at Jerusalem; 32 while Peter, and the others with him, were overwhelm'd with sleep: but when they wak'd, they observed his glory, and the two persons present with him, 33 who were just departing from him, when Peter said to Jesus, master, it is best for us to stay here: let us build three apartments, one for you, one for Moses, and one for Elias: not knowing well what he said. 34 while he was speaking, there came a cloud and over-shadowed them, who were seized with fear, at their vanishing in the cloud, 35 from whence a voice issued out, saying, "this is my beloved son, obey him." 36 and before the sound was gone, Jesus was left alone: this they kept secret, and for some time did not acquaint any one in the least with what they had seen.
